University City, St. Louis, MO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in University City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| University City Studio Apartments | $1,754 | $1,100 | $2,200 |
| University City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,245 | $550 | $3,300 |
| University City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,821 | $669 | $6,500 |
| University City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,874 | $687 | $6,620 |
| University City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,082 | $893 | $3,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about University City Apartments with Swimming Pool
What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in University City?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in University City with Swimming Pool is at University Commons listed at $550.
How much is the average rent for University City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in University City with Swimming Pool is $2,384.
What is the largest University City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in University City is a 2,477 square feet unit starting from $1,817 at Mansions on the Plaza Apartments.
What is the average size for University City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in University City is currently at 615 sq ft.
